Efforts to remove SA from the UK’s Covid-19 red list intensified

Published on

The Minister for International Relations and Co-operation, Naledi Pandor says efforts have been boosted to remove South Africa from the UK covid-19 red list.

Citizens from countries on the list, are not allowed to travel to the UK.

Pandor says a steady decrease in Covid-19 infections and more people getting vaccinated on a daily basis are some of the reasons why SA should be removed from this list.

She says officials are in talks with the UK government to have SA removed from the list.
